Post-Grad Field Experience

Some states require supervised clinical experience after the required degree is earned, in order to earn a professional license. This differs by license. For example, typically licenses issued by a state Department of Education (i.e. School Counselor or School Psychologist) do not require this post-graduate experience.

It is each learner's responsibility to secure a post-graduate field experience placement. Generally, a learner will begin seeking appropriate supervisors during their time as a student. Supervisors can be found through informational interviews, networking, and professional associations. Don't underestimate the importance of this step in the process. Usually these are unpaid experiences, or minimally paid. Remember that the requirements may make is impossible to work another full-time job.

These always occur after graduation. Most mental health degrees will also have field-work experience as part of the program. In some states, part of these hours may count towards post-graduate field experience. Read your state's rules/requirements carefully.
